WebAug 17, 2024 · The average SNAP allowance will increase by $36.24 per person per month, or $1.19 per day, Protas said. For a family of four receiving the maximum benefit, they'll …

WebAug 17, 2024 · That review determined that the current cost of a nutritious diet was 21 percent higher than the TFP allowed for in SNAP benefits. As a result, the USDA will increase the average monthly SNAP benefit by roughly 25 percent, an average increase of $36.24 per person, or $1.19 per day.
